Aquatred
The Aquatred may be the most perfect type of conditioning and rehabilitation for the equine athlete. It enhances and maintains conditioning in a full-body exercise, giving the horse a perfect balance of strength. The 40-60% buoyancy is the key to giving range of motion back to an injured athlete, as well as increasing length of stride of an older athlete, bringing it back to its original state.
The resistance of the water and the lack of concussion enable horses to work themselves fully and with no pain, using the same muscle groups as on land. The Aquatred is not as cardiovascular a workout as swimming, but is perfect for any performance related athlete.
Benefits of the Aquatred:
Decreases track-related injuries during the conditioning of your horse, helps the reconditioning of veteran athletes, or the freshening of animals long in training.
Safe alternative to hand-walking in pose-surgical care, offering less chance of re-injury, better healing, and speedier return to normal activity.
Track sour horses are mentally revitalized by the new activity, while conditioning is maintained and improved.
Lengthens stride while developing the same muscles used in normal ground work and on the race track
Helps bleeders heal while maintaining condition.
Great when combined with swimming for a more complete conditioning program.
When low impact is what is required, this is the perfect exercise.

Equigym
The Equigym provides a safe and natural form of exercise and cool-down after a workout. Moving stalls in a round pen configuration - with the horse not tied down as in the traditional hot walker - gives the horse an enjoyable safe walk without handler intervention. Our Equigym is in a controlled building and environment to keep horses calm and safe.
Movement in the Equigym is stress-free, unrestrained, safe and free at a walk.
Ability to work both directions insures balanced, uniform development of the musculoskeletal system.

Swimming
Our state-of-the-art swimming pool provides all of the benefits of aerobic exercise in a strong conditioning program without stressing the tendons, ligaments and muscles of the leg.
Maintains muscle tone and cardiopulmonary capacity
Increases mental alertness and freshness in track sour horses
Great when used in conjunction with Aquatred and Equigym for complete rehabilitation and cross training effect.

Solarium
An important part of our synergistic approach to equine rehabilitation from illness and injury is our solarium. The benefits of sunshine cannot be debated, and providing sunshine to the recovering athlete in a controlled, indoor environment enhances rapid return to training. Like humans, horses are healthier when exposed to regular doses of sunlight. Sun light has been proven to stimulate the immune system and provide vitamin D. Vitamin D aids in proper absorption of calcium and phosphates, which are the building blocks of healthy bone.
When used in conjunction with our other therapeutic activities, the solarium enhances mental and physical wellness in the equine athlete.
Takes the chill away on cold days to help relax muscles and dry the horses more rapidly.
Eases sore back pain.
